4

Я хотел бы установить и загрузить Windows с карты microSD с помощью Nifty MiniDrive, однако, прежде чем платить за устройство и карту microSD, я хотел бы увидеть различия в производительности между различными скоростями карт microSD, чтобы увидеть, хочу ли я вообще сделай это. Есть ли способ ограничить скорость ввода-вывода Windows и, таким образом, симулировать запуск с карты microSD? Любые мысли по поводу производительности запуска с карты microSD. [Windows будет использоваться только с VisualStudio, Visio и некоторыми экземплярами трехмерной графики OpenGL]

Я бы установил карту MicroSD на MacBook Pro с максимальной скоростью до 480 Мбит / с, что составляет примерно 60 МБ / с. MiniDrive не имеет ограничений по формату или скорости используемой в нем карты microSD. Ограничивающим фактором является скорость / совместимость устройства чтения карт SD в MacBook. Карты MicroSD поддерживают скорость чтения 30 МБ / с (16 ГБ за 18–64 ГБ за 60 долларов) и 95 МБ / с (8 ГБ за 26 долларов, 16 ГБ за 56 долларов). Я хотел бы иметь место и получить карту памяти microSD на 64 ГБ, однако, интересно, будет ли она достаточно быстрой. Двойная скорость или двойной пробел.

2 ответа2

2

Я не могу рассказать вам о способах его тестирования, но я могу рассказать кое-что о производительности. Передовые SD-карты оптимизированы для записи фильмов, что означает последовательную запись (и чтение). Объявленные скорости обычно предназначены для последовательного доступа. Вы получите наибольшее замедление от приложений, выполняющих много случайного доступа к диску. Компилятор - это одна из тех программ, которая должна читать из большого количества файлов (даже без учета файлов в вашем проекте) и работать плохо. Если ваш 3D-рендеринг читает много моделей с диска, это то же самое. Веб-браузеры также являются примерами программ, которые делают много случайного доступа к диску. В целом можно сказать, что более сложные программы, которые пытаются сохранить память, сильно пострадают от производительности. Однако существуют SD-карты с исключительной скоростью произвольного доступа, как правило, с одноуровневой сотовой архитектурой. Они не приходят дешево. Хорошая USB-флешка или маленький внешний жесткий диск могут быть хорошим компромиссом в отношении стоимости, производительности и простоты использования.

0

Хм. Есть способы симуляции медленного процессора и симуляции медленной сети, но симуляция медленного диска, по-видимому, выходит за рамки большинства вещей, которые люди рассматривают при работе на машинах.

Самая близкая вещь, которую я могу найти, это хлопать диск циклами чтения / записи, но это, конечно, не очень точно.

Вообще говоря, проблем с запуском ОС с SD-карты не так много. Могут быть некоторые проблемы с долговечностью диска, если он используется для пространства подкачки или файлов журнала, которые постоянно изменяются. Самая большая проблема, которую вы заметите, это то, что начальное время загрузки больше, просто потому, что диск имеет ограничения по скорости. Оказавшись в среде Windows, он вытянет необходимые элементы в память и будет отлично пыхтеть. Если среда разработки - это все, что вам нужно из этой установки, она должна нормально работать в ваших целях.

Ищите карты класса 10 (класс - это рейтинг скорости) и избегайте грязных дешевых карт класса 4. Некоторые из этих производителей любят выдумывать цифры.

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.